Introduction to the Fukushima Educational Initiative
In an effort to enhance understanding and management of environmental radiation, a comprehensive lecture series was conducted, focusing on the fundamental aspects of radiation and its monitoring, environmental remediation, decontamination, and radioactive waste management. These educational sessions were grounded in the IAEA Safety Standards, a globally recognized benchmark for nuclear safety protocols.
Hands-On Experience for Students
Alongside the lectures, students participated in a practical workshop designed to provide hands-on experience with radiation detection technologies. This involved the use of various devices to measure radiation levels in environmental samples, including soil and minerals. Such practical exercises are invaluable for students, offering them a tangible understanding of radiation monitoring techniques and their real-world applications.
Encouraging Local Academic Engagement
Hiroshi Aoki, who was serving as the Director General of the Fukushima Prefectural Centre for Environmental Creation at the time, expressed optimism about the initiative. He stated, “I would expect that the IAEA lectures will motivate Fukushima Prefecture university students to learn more about environmental radiation as a subject and the current state of environmental remediation in the prefecture.”
This sentiment was echoed by Kenichiro Tanaka, Director of the International Nuclear Cooperation Division at Japan’s Ministry of Foreign Affairs. He added, “We hope the younger generation will learn from the collective knowledge and experience of the IAEA and apply this to the next steps for reconstruction and revitalization in Fukushima Prefecture, which would also contribute to international nuclear safety.”
The Background and Future of the Program
This lecture series was a pilot exercise conducted at the end of 2024. It was initiated under a cooperation agreement between the Government of Japan and the IAEA, which began in 2012 and is set to continue until 2027. This agreement facilitates the IAEA’s assistance to Fukushima Prefecture in various areas, including radiation monitoring, environmental remediation, decontamination, and waste management, all aligned with IAEA safety standards.
Student Perspectives and the Road Ahead
Hiroki Furuchi, a student from Higashi Nippon International University, shared his aspirations following the lectures. He mentioned, “After the lectures, I hope to be able to share accurate information about radiation with those around me when the topic comes up on television or other media.” This reflects the program’s goal of empowering students to become informed communicators about environmental issues.
The feedback collected from this initial course will be crucial for the IAEA. It will guide the refinement of the program content to better meet the specific needs of Fukushima Prefecture, ensuring alignment with IAEA Safety Standards. The program is scheduled to expand to more universities in Fukushima in 2025, thereby broadening its impact.
Understanding Radiation and Its Management
For those unfamiliar with the technical jargon, radiation refers to the energy emitted from a source, which can be natural or man-made. Radiation monitoring involves measuring the level of radiation in the environment to ensure it remains within safe limits. Environmental remediation and decontamination are processes aimed at reducing radiation levels in affected areas, making them safe for habitation and use. Radioactive waste management involves the safe disposal of materials that emit radiation to prevent harm to people and the environment.

Good to Know: The Role of the IAEA
The International Atomic Energy Agency (IAEA) plays a pivotal role in promoting the peaceful use of nuclear energy. It provides support and guidance to countries around the world in implementing safe nuclear practices. This includes developing safety standards, providing technical assistance, and facilitating international cooperation on nuclear safety and security.
